Our project is a big confectionary plant situated in Russia.
According to the local standards we are not allowed to lay air ducts and make supply ventilation for such premises as stair halls and elevator halls. We can only place there smoke ventilation for these premises. What I don't understand is whether we need to provide supply ventilation for this kind of spaces to comply with this prerequisite requirements or not as these premises are non-occupied.

If they are not normally occupied corridors or stairwells, then they do not require ventilation. This would apply to ones that are used for emergency egress only.
